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
73 changes: 1 addition & 72 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-28,78 +28,7 @@ If you like using it, please consider a donation:**

Table of Contents
=================
* [Skynet\-IADS](#skynet-iads)
* [Abstract](#abstract)
* [Quick start](#quick-start)
* [Skynet IADS Elements](#skynet-iads-elements)
* [IADS](#iads)
* [Track files](#track-files)
* [Comand Centers](#comand-centers)
* [SAM Sites](#sam-sites)
* [Early Warning Radars](#early-warning-radars)
* [Power Sources](#power-sources)
* [Connection Nodes](#connection-nodes)
* [AWACS (Airborne Early Warning and Control System)
](#awacs-airborne-early-warning-and-control-system)
* [Ships](#ships)
* [Tactics](#tactics)
* [HARM defence](#harm-defence)
* [HARM detection](#harm-detection)
* [HARM flight path analysis](#harm-flight-path-analysis)
* [HARM radar shutdown](#harm-radar-shutdown)
* [Point defence](#point-defence)
* [Electronic Warfare](#electronic-warfare)
* [Using Skynet in the mission editor](#using-skynet-in-the-mission-editor)
* [Placing units](#placing-units)
* [Preparing a SAM site](#preparing-a-sam-site)
* [Preparing an EW radar](#preparing-an-ew-radar)
* [Adding the Skynet code](#adding-the-skynet-code)
* [Adding the Skynet IADS](#adding-the-skynet-iads)
* [Advanced setup](#advanced-setup)
* [IADS configuration](#iads-configuration)
* [Adding a command center](#adding-a-command-center)
* [Power sources and connection nodes](#power-sources-and-connection-nodes)
* [Warm up the SAM sites of an IADS](#warm-up-the-sam-sites-of-an-iads)
* [Connecting Skynet to the MOOSE AI\_A2A\_DISPATCHER](#connecting-skynet-to-the-moose-ai_a2a_dispatcher)
* [SAM site configuration](#sam-site-configuration)
* [Adding SAM sites](#adding-sam-sites)
* [Add multiple SAM sites](#add-multiple-sam-sites)
* [Add a SAM site manually](#add-a-sam-site-manually)
* [Accessing SAM sites in the IADS](#accessing-sam-sites-in-the-iads)
* [Act as EW radar](#act-as-ew-radar)
* [Engagement zone](#engagement-zone)
* [Engagement zone options](#engagement-zone-options)
* [Engage air weapons](#engage-air-weapons)
* [Engage HARM](#engage-harm)
* [Add go live constraints](#add-go-live-constraints)
* [Use cases](#use-cases)
* [Contact](#contact)
* [EW radar configuration](#ew-radar-configuration)
* [Adding EW radars](#adding-ew-radars)
* [Add multiple EW radars](#add-multiple-ew-radars)
* [Add an EW radar manually](#add-an-ew-radar-manually)
* [Accessing EW radars in the IADS](#accessing-ew-radars-in-the-iads)
* [Options for SAM sites and EW radars](#options-for-sam-sites-and-ew-radars)
* [Setting an option](#setting-an-option)
* [Daisy chaining options](#daisy-chaining-options)
* [HARM Defence](#harm-defence-1)
* [Point defence](#point-defence-1)
* [Autonomous mode behaviour](#autonomous-mode-behaviour)
* [Autonomous mode options](#autonomous-mode-options)
* [Adding a jammer](#adding-a-jammer)
* [Advanced functions](#advanced-functions)
* [Setting debug information](#setting-debug-information)
* [Example Setup](#example-setup)
* [FAQ](#faq)
* [Does Skynet IADS have an impact on game performance?](#does-skynet-iads-have-an-impact-on-game-performance)
* [What air defence units shall I add to the Skynet IADS?](#what-air-defence-units-shall-i-add-to-the-skynet-iads)
* [Which SAM systems can engage HARMS?](#which-sam-systems-can-engage-harms)
* [What exactly does Skynet do with the SAMS?](#what-exactly-does-skynet-do-with-the-sams)
* [Are there known bugs?](#are-there-known-bugs)
* [How do I know if a SAM site is in range of an EW site or a SAM site in EW mode?](#how-do-i-know-if-a-sam-site-is-in-range-of-an-ew-site-or-a-sam-site-in-ew-mode)
* [How do I connect Skynet with the MOOSE AI\_A2A\_DISPATCHER and what are the benefits of that?](#how-do-i-connect-skynet-with-the-moose-ai_a2a_dispatcher-and-what-are-the-benefits-of-that)
* [Thanks](#thanks)



# Quick start
Tired of reading already? Download the [demo mission](/demo-missions/skynet-test-persian-gulf.miz) in the persian gulf map and see Skynet in action. More complex demo missions will follow soon.
Expand Down
26 changes: 25 additions & 1 deletion build-tools/build-compiled-script.ps1
Original file line number Diff line number Diff line change
Expand Up @@ -11,7 +11,31 @@ if (Test-Path ./tmp/skynet-iads-compiled.lua) {
Remove-Item ./tmp/skynet-iads-compiled.lua
}
Add-Content ./tmp/tmp-time.lua ("env.info(`"--- SKYNET VERSION: "+$version+" | BUILD TIME: "+(Get-Date -date (Get-Date).ToUniversalTime()-uformat "%d.%m.%Y %H%MZ")+" ---`")")
cat ../skynet-iads-source/skynet-iads-supported-types.lua, ../skynet-iads-source/highdigitsams/skynet-iads-high-digit-sams-suported-types.lua, ../skynet-iads-source/skynet-iads-logger.lua, ../skynet-iads-source/skynet-iads.lua, ../skynet-iads-source/skynet-mooose-a2a-dispatcher-connector.lua, ../skynet-iads-source/skynet-iads-table-delegator.lua, ../skynet-iads-source/skynet-iads-abstract-dcs-object-wrapper.lua, ../skynet-iads-source/skynet-iads-abstract-element.lua, ../skynet-iads-source/skynet-iads-abstract-radar-element.lua, ../skynet-iads-source/skynet-iads-awacs-radar.lua, ../skynet-iads-source/skynet-iads-command-center.lua, ../skynet-iads-source/skynet-iads-contact.lua, ../skynet-iads-source/skynet-iads-early-warning-radar.lua, ../skynet-iads-source/skynet-iads-jammer.lua, ../skynet-iads-source/skynet-iads-sam-search-radar.lua, ../skynet-iads-source/skynet-iads-sam-site.lua, ../skynet-iads-source/skynet-iads-sam-tracking-radar.lua, ../skynet-iads-source/syknet-iads-sam-launcher.lua, ../skynet-iads-source/skynet-iads-harm-detection.lua | sc ./tmp/tmp-code.lua
cat ../skynet-iads-source/skynet-iads-supported-types.lua,
../skynet-iads-source/highdigitsams/skynet-iads-high-digit-sams-suported-types.lua,
../skynet-iads-source/sampack_s300/skynet-iads-sampack-s300-suported-types.lua,
../skynet-iads-source/currenthill/skynet-iads-currenthill-russia-suported-types.lua,
../skynet-iads-source/currenthill/skynet-iads-currenthill-us-suported-types.lua,
../skynet-iads-source/currenthill/skynet-iads-currenthill-uk-suported-types.lua,
../skynet-iads-source/currenthill/skynet-iads-currenthill-germany-suported-types.lua,
../skynet-iads-source/currenthill/skynet-iads-currenthill-china-suported-types.lua,
../skynet-iads-source/skynet-iads-logger.lua,
../skynet-iads-source/skynet-iads.lua,
../skynet-iads-source/skynet-mooose-a2a-dispatcher-connector.lua,
../skynet-iads-source/skynet-iads-table-delegator.lua,
../skynet-iads-source/skynet-iads-abstract-dcs-object-wrapper.lua,
../skynet-iads-source/skynet-iads-abstract-element.lua,
../skynet-iads-source/skynet-iads-abstract-radar-element.lua,
../skynet-iads-source/skynet-iads-awacs-radar.lua,
../skynet-iads-source/skynet-iads-command-center.lua,
../skynet-iads-source/skynet-iads-contact.lua,
../skynet-iads-source/skynet-iads-early-warning-radar.lua,
../skynet-iads-source/skynet-iads-jammer.lua,
../skynet-iads-source/skynet-iads-sam-search-radar.lua,
../skynet-iads-source/skynet-iads-sam-site.lua,
../skynet-iads-source/skynet-iads-sam-tracking-radar.lua,
../skynet-iads-source/syknet-iads-sam-launcher.lua,
../skynet-iads-source/skynet-iads-harm-detection.lua | sc ./tmp/tmp-code.lua
$code = Get-Content ./tmp/tmp-code.lua
Add-Content ./tmp/tmp-time.lua $code
Rename-Item -Path ./tmp/tmp-time.lua -NewName skynet-iads-compiled.lua
Expand Down
Loading